Our Door Installation Services in Gardena

Entry & Swing Doors

Most Gardena homes we visit still carry their original 1950s or 1960s front door, often hollow-core, often on a steel frame that’s been quietly oxidizing for sixty years. We replace these with fiberglass or steel doors on fusion-welded frames, set with stainless hinges and full flashing tape around the jamb. The difference isn’t cosmetic. It’s a door that opens in August without a shoulder against it.

Entry & Swing Doors

Storm Doors

Storm doors in Gardena face a specific enemy: morning fog that doesn’t burn off until ten, leaving a film of salt-laden moisture on every exposed surface. We spec storm doors with marine-grade finishes and aluminum or vinyl construction, because a powder-coated steel storm door will show rust at the hinge screws within three winters here. We also make sure the storm door sweep and threshold seal are rated for continuous high humidity, not inland dry air.

Storm Doors

Bifold & Folding Doors

Bifold and folding doors are popular on the larger ranch homes in Gardena that have opened up their rear walls toward patios. The challenge on these installs is air infiltration at the seam seals. In this marine layer, a folding door that isn’t weather-sealed correctly will leak conditioned air and fog the glass panels every morning from October through June. We use multi-point locking systems and dual weatherstripping on every folding door we hang in Gardena.

Bifold & Folding Doors

Double & French Doors

A double French door on a Gardena bungalow needs more than a pretty pane. It needs a reinforced header above the opening, an astragal that seals tight enough to keep marine moisture out, and hardware that won’t corrode where the two doors meet. We’ve pulled enough interior-grade hinge screws out of old French door installs in this city to know that corners cut during installation don’t show up for five years, and then they show up ugly.

Double & French Doors

Pivot Doors

Pivot doors are showing up on some of the newer and renovated homes in Gardena, and they demand a different kind of precision. The pivot system carries all the weight of the slab, so the rough opening has to be dead level and the floor connection perfectly shimmed. In Gardena’s older slabs and raised foundations, that often means minor structural prep before the door goes in. We handle that in-house rather than sending you to a second contractor.

Common Door Installation Problems We See in Gardena Homes

  • Rusted steel door frames and hinges. Salt-air oxidation from the persistent marine layer eats mild steel faster here than in Compton or Hawthorne, a few miles further inland. Doors start binding at the striker plate, then the hinge screws strip out, and suddenly the door won’t close at all.
  • Swollen, crumbling weatherstripping and threshold seals. Gardena’s morning fog works its way under doors year-round. Once the threshold seal fails, moisture wicks into the subfloor, the jamb swells, and the door starts catching on the bottom edge.
  • Replacement doors installed with interior-grade fasteners. A door hung with zinc-plated screws and no flashing tape looks fine for a year or two. After three or four foggy winters, the screws corrode, the flashing fails, and air leaks around the entire perimeter. We strip these out and re-hang the door correctly.
  • Failed insulated glass units in patio and French doors. Persistent humidity plus thermal cycling means sealed units on older patio doors fog up permanently. If the seal is gone, the glass has to be replaced, not just cleaned.

Pricing for Door Installation in Gardena, CA

A single entry door replacement in Gardena generally runs $1,800 to $4,200, depending on the door material, frame condition, and whether hardware needs to be upgraded to stainless or marine-grade. Storm doors typically fall between $900 and $2,200 installed. Bifold and folding doors run $3,500 to $8,000 for a typical patio opening. Double French doors land in the $3,000 to $6,500 range. The coastal-spec version of any of these costs $300 to $700 more than the inland-spec version, and it is worth every dollar. A door built for inland conditions, hung with zinc hardware and no flashing tape, will start corroding and leaking within a decade in Gardena’s salt air. Door Installation in Gardena: What the Salt Air Changes

Gardena sits roughly five to six miles from the Pacific, squarely in the persistent South Bay marine layer zone. That means morning fog, high relative humidity, and mild salt-laden air more days than not. For door hardware, this is a slow, relentless attack. Original hollow-core exterior doors on 1950s bungalows here often sit in steel frames that have been oxidizing since Eisenhower was president. The weatherstripping swells with moisture and crumbles. The threshold seals fail, and the morning fog wicks under the door into the subfloor.

Our crew recently replaced a rotted hollow-core front door on a ranch home in Gardena’s Moneta neighborhood. The original steel frame had rusted badly enough to jam the door shut from the inside. We installed a Milgard fiberglass entry door with a fusion-welded frame, stainless steel hinges, and full flashing tape around the jamb, then sealed the threshold to stop salt-laden morning fog from wicking into the subfloor. That job is the kind of thing we see on a regular basis in every Gardena neighborhood, from the El Camino Village side down to the 110-adjacent blocks.

The difference between a coastal-spec door and an inland-spec door is simple. The inland version uses zinc-plated hinges, mild steel fasteners, and standard weatherstripping. It is cheaper by a few hundred dollars. The coastal version uses stainless or hot-dip galvanized hardware, marine-grade flashing, and humidity-rated seals. The inland version starts binding and leaking within five to eight years in Gardena. The coastal version is still square and sealing at twenty. We quote both on paper and let you decide, but we will always tell you straight: in this city, the cheap spec costs more within a decade.

Gardena’s housing stock is overwhelming postwar, roughly 900 to 1,200 square feet, built between 1945 and 1965. Many of those homes still carry original aluminum jalousie windows and hollow-core exterior doors well past their service life. The doors are the quiet problem. They let air in, they let moisture in, and they make the whole house work harder than it should. Replacing them with a properly sealed, properly flashed modern door changes how the entire entryway performs. For a Gardena homeowner who plans to stay in the house another twenty years, it is not an upgrade. It is a correction.
